Tonight we put it down, we talked about parents' legal rights to evict their deadbeat children, we heard from a non-custodial parent asking about her rights respecting child support, we heard a question from a tenant in a Housing Project on how to protect her right to quiet enjoyment from Bookie and them, Mickey posed a question on our FaceBook page, seeking advice about being gay but not out at work, and being taunted by his co-workers.  This is just a small flavor of the questions that we addressed tonight.
